Overview
The GC-RC05 is built around a widened, thickened seat cushion (20.47" wide, 4" thick) packed with independent 2.0mm pocket springs layered over high-density foam. The result is a flat, supportive base that distributes weight evenly and doesn't squeeze your thighs the way typical racing-style shells tend to do. The breathable tech fabric covering resists wear and pet scratches, making it a solid pick for homes where things get a little rough.
Key Features
- Pocket spring + high-density foam cushion, 40% wider seating area vs standard chairs
- USB-powered massage motor built into the oversized lumbar pillow (11" x 3.1")
- 135-degree recline with extendable footrest for full rest mode
- Class-A high-strength metal frame with explosion-proof thickened base
- Class-3 gas lift, supports up to 350 lbs / 158 kg
- Silent universal floor-protecting caster wheels
- Suitable for users between 150-195 cm tall
Who is it for?
Gamers and remote workers who spend long hours seated and want sofa-level comfort without paying premium chair prices. It also works well for anyone who runs warm, since the fabric breathes way better than vinyl or PU alternatives. The massage lumbar is a genuine plus after a long session.
Pros and Cons
- Pro: Pocket spring seat is a rare feature at this tier
- Pro: Fabric is breathable, durable and scratch-resistant
- Pro: USB massage lumbar is actually useful day-to-day
- Con: Assembly takes time and patience
- Con: Massage function won't replace a dedicated massage device
